Highly detailed 3D-printable miniature western saloon pool table, modeled on late 19th-century billiard tables. Perfect for dollhouses, western dioramas, and model-railroad layouts. The download includes print-ready parts for the tabletop, legs, and pockets designed for easy printing and clean assembly. Features: - Accurate period styling with carved leg detail and trimmed rails - Separate parts to minimize supports and simplify painting - Scales easily for 1:24, 1:18, HO, N and other common miniature scales Printing recommendations: - File format: STL - Layer height: 0.12–0.20 mm for best detail - Infill: 10–20% (higher for durable pieces) - Supports: minimal; recommended for underside of rails and pockets - Adhesive: cyanoacrylate or plastic cement for assembly - Post-process: light sanding and a primer coat before painting Uses: dollhouses, western and Victorian dioramas, tabletop gaming, and model-railroading scenery.
